Transaction 5ea56e2a92b7fbb21663c1178ff9a638c99fd39c33ebdeabb28430aaa3a706ae
1 Input
1 Output
-
5ea56e2a92b7fbb21663c1178ff9a638c99fd39c33ebdeabb28430aaa3a706ae:0
- value
- 670425
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f6336856bb51b68c83afaa5e336b485acc20a50 OP_EQUAL
- address
- 38vnA8skuhAzGytPSausURjyBxkCeMCFEH